Avatar

Please consider registering
guest

sp_LogInOut Log In sp_Registration Register

Register | Lost password?
Advanced Search

— Forum Scope —




— Match —





— Forum Options —





Minimum search word length is 3 characters - maximum search word length is 84 characters

sp_Feed Topic RSS sp_TopicIcon
UaSimulationServer.exe sporadically hangs at start in main thread in javafx.scene.Scene
December 13, 2023
18:42, EET
Avatar
in-fke
Member
Members
Forum Posts: 35
Member Since:
June 8, 2016
sp_UserOfflineSmall Offline

Hangs and nothing (no UI) shows up, until terminated. Happens sporadically.

“SimulationServer” #1 prio=5 os_prio=0 cpu=3093.75ms elapsed=6148.13s tid=0x00000000036b74e0 nid=0x8ed0 in Object.wait() [0x0000000002e8c000]
java.lang.Thread.State: RUNNABLE
at javafx.scene.Scene.(Scene.java:390)
– waiting on the Class initialization monitor for com.sun.javafx.scene.SceneHelper
at com.prosysopc.ua.app.simserver.ui.UI.(SourceFile:253)
at j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ance0(java.base@17.0.5/Native Method)
at j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ance(java.base@17.0.5/NativeConstructorAccessorImpl.java:77)
at jdk.internal.reflect.DelegatingConstructorAccessorImpl.newInstance(java.base@17.0.5/D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stanceWithCaller(java.base@17.0.5/Constructor.java:499)
at java.lang.reflect.Constructor.newInstance(java.base@17.0.5/Constructor.java:480)
at com.google.inject.internal.DefaultConstructionProxyFactory$ReflectiveProxy.newInstance(DefaultConstructionProxyFactory.java:120)
at com.google.inject.internal.ConstructorInjector.provision(ConstructorInjector.java:114)
at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:91)
at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:300)
at com.google.inject.internal.ProviderToInternalFactoryAdapter.get(ProviderToInternalFactoryAdapter.java:40)
at com.google.inject.internal.SingletonScope$1.get(SingletonScope.java:169)
at com.google.inject.internal.InternalFactoryToProviderAdapter.get(InternalFactoryToProviderAdapter.java:45)
at com.google.inject.internal.InternalInjectorCreator.loadEagerSingletons(InternalInjectorCreator.java:213)
at com.google.inject.internal.InternalInjectorCreator.injectDynamically(InternalInjectorCreator.java:186)
at com.google.inject.internal.InternalInjectorCreator.build(InternalInjectorCreator.java:113)
at com.google.inject.Guice.createInjector(Guice.java:87)
at com.google.inject.Guice.createInjector(Guice.java:69)
at com.prosysopc.ua.app.simserver.i.b(SourceFile:54)
at com.prosysopc.ua.app.simserver.SimulationServer.main(SourceFile:33)
at com.prosysopc.ua.app.Main.main(Main.java:13)
at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(java.base@17.0.5/Native Method)
at jdk.internal.reflect.NativeMethodAccessorImpl.invoke(java.base@17.0.5/NativeMethodAccessorImpl.java:77)
at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(java.base@17.0.5/D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(java.base@17.0.5/Method.java:568)
at com.exe4j.runtime.LauncherEngine.launch(LauncherEngine.java:84)
at com.exe4j.runtime.WinLauncher.main(WinLauncher.java:94)
at com.install4j.runtime.launcher.WinLauncher.main(WinLauncher.java:25)

Other Thread

“JavaFX Application Thread” #26 prio=5 os_prio=0 cpu=93.75ms elapsed=6143.97s tid=0x000000003410c910 nid=0x86ec in Object.wait() [0x000000003608d000]
java.lang.Thread.State: RUNNABLE
at java.lang.Class.forName0(java.base@17.0.5/Native Method)
– waiting on the Class initialization monitor for javafx.scene.Scene
at java.lang.Class.forName(java.base@17.0.5/Class.java:467)
at com.sun.javafx.util.Utils.forceInit(Utils.java:866)
at com.sun.javafx.scene.SceneHelper.(SceneHelper.java:47)
at javafx.stage.PopupWindow.(PopupWindow.java:163)
at javafx.scene.control.PopupControl.(PopupControl.java:115)
at javafx.scene.control.Tooltip.(Tooltip.java:166)
at org.controlsfx.validation.decoration.GraphicValidationDecoration.createTooltip(GraphicValidationDecoration.java:126)
at org.controlsfx.validation.decoration.GraphicValidationDecoration.createDecorationNode(GraphicValidationDecoration.java:109)
at org.controlsfx.validation.decoration.GraphicValidationDecoration.createValidationDecorations(GraphicValidationDecoration.java:149)
at org.controlsfx.validation.decoration.AbstractValidationDecoration.applyValidationDecoration(AbstractValidationDecoration.java:86)
at de.saxsys.mvvmfx.utils.validation.visualization.ControlsFxVisualizer.applyVisualization(ControlsFxVisualizer.java:70)
at de.saxsys.mvvmfx.utils.validation.visualization.ValidationVisualizerBase.lambda$initVisualization$2(ValidationVisualizerBase.java:49)
at de.saxsys.mvvmfx.utils.validation.visualization.ValidationVisualizerBase$$Lambda$444/0x0000000800822f30.run(Unknown Source)
at com.sun.javafx.application.PlatformImpl.lambda$runLater$10(PlatformImpl.java:457)
at com.sun.javafx.application.PlatformImpl$$Lambda$231/0x0000000800327248.run(Unknown Source)
at java.security.AccessController.executePrivileged(java.base@17.0.5/AccessController.java:776)
at java.security.AccessController.doPrivileged(java.base@17.0.5/AccessController.java:399)
at com.sun.javafx.application.PlatformImpl.lambda$runLater$11(PlatformImpl.java:456)
at com.sun.javafx.application.PlatformImpl$$Lambda$229/0x0000000800323d60.run(Unknown Source)
at com.sun.glass.ui.InvokeLaterDispatcher$Future.run(InvokeLaterDispatcher.java:96)
at com.sun.glass.ui.win.WinApplication._runLoop(Native Method)
at com.sun.glass.ui.win.WinApplication.lambda$runLoop$3(WinApplication.java:184)
at com.sun.glass.ui.win.WinApplication$$Lambda$220/0x0000000800319a18.run(Unknown Source)
at java.lang.Thread.run(java.base@17.0.5/Thread.java:833)

December 14, 2023
12:59, EET
Avatar
Bjarne Boström
Moderator
Moderators
Forum Posts: 1026
Member Since:
April 3, 2012
sp_UserOfflineSmall Offline

Hi,

That looks like a deadlock in classloaders, thanks for the report. I hope we can fix this for the next release, though that most likely it wont happen this year, maybe in January.

Forum Timezone: Europe/Helsinki

Most Users Ever Online: 1919

Currently Online:
58 Guest(s)

Currently Browsing this Page:
1 Guest(s)

Top Posters:

Heikki Tahvanainen: 402

hbrackel: 144

rocket science: 88

pramanj: 86

Francesco Zambon: 83

Ibrahim: 78

Sabari: 62

kapsl: 57

gjevremovic: 49

Xavier: 43

Member Stats:

Guest Posters: 0

Members: 734

Moderators: 7

Admins: 1

Forum Stats:

Groups: 3

Forums: 15

Topics: 1523

Posts: 6449

Newest Members:

christamcdowall, redaahern07571, nigelbdhmp, travistimmons, AnnelCib, dalenegettinger, howardkennerley, Thomassnism, biancacraft16, edgardo3518

Moderators: Jouni Aro: 1026, Pyry: 1, Petri: 0, Bjarne Boström: 1026, Jimmy Ni: 26, Matti Siponen: 346, Lusetti: 0

Administrators: admin: 1